About The Position

This full-time, on-site position is ideal for an Associate-level physician looking to make a meaningful impact in patient care within a growing Medical Practice. In this role, you will provide comprehensive primary care services, focusing on preventive care, diagnosis, treatment, and coordination of care. You will work collaboratively with a supportive clinical team to deliver high-quality, patient-centered outcomes and help build lasting patient relationships in the community.

Responsibilities

  • Provide comprehensive primary care services to patients across a range of health needs
  • Obtain detailed patient histories and perform thorough physical examinations
  • Diagnose and treat acute and chronic conditions commonly managed in primary care
  • Develop individualized care plans in collaboration with patients and their families
  • Order, perform, and interpret diagnostic tests and procedures as needed
  • Prescribe medications and therapies according to clinical best practices
  • Provide preventive care services, including health screenings, immunizations, and wellness counseling
  • Educate patients on lifestyle modifications, disease prevention, and chronic disease management
  • Coordinate care with specialists, nurses, and other healthcare professionals
  • Maintain accurate, timely, and confidential electronic health records
  • Participate in quality improvement initiatives and patient safety programs
  • Stay current with developments in primary care medicine and relevant clinical guidelines
